Ordinals
beta
Sat 1360885721082566
decimal
334354.721082566
degree
0°124354′1714″721082566‴
percentile
64.80408202759719%
name
efciisfbwzz
cycle
0
epoch
1
period
165
block
334354
offset
721082566
timestamp
2014-12-15 01:34:15 UTC
rarity
common
prev
next